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
126914038 11129969387 40453368529 34180090 96
07554515339 2656 8095911429
07554515339 2656 8095911429
408098293 5241 468334
All about undefined
Interested in learning more?
07554515339 2656 8095911429
408098293 5241 468334
See more
5524760 44749647143 4206
9706201322 1864795733 0219725
See more
27120241 220473 93520066
017501747 747 919219173 071547
See more